From af1ad45431f50fe6854c3cab15cfe7a92eb1d41c Mon Sep 17 00:00:00 2001 From: Rob Garrison Date: Tue, 9 Oct 2018 06:47:16 -0500 Subject: [PATCH] Core: Fix JS error. Closes #699 --- js/jquery.keyboard.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/js/jquery.keyboard.js b/js/jquery.keyboard.js index 416b8fb7..5afd74f1 100644 --- a/js/jquery.keyboard.js +++ b/js/jquery.keyboard.js @@ -1125,7 +1125,7 @@ http://www.opensource.org/licenses/mit-license.php if (o.useWheel && base.wheel) { // get keys from other layers/keysets (shift, alt, meta, etc) that line up by data-position // target mousewheel selected key - $key = last.wheel_$Keys && last.wheelIndex > -1 ? last.wheel_$Keys.eq(last.wheelIndex) : $key; + $key = last.wheel_$Keys.length && last.wheelIndex > -1 ? last.wheel_$Keys.eq(last.wheelIndex) : $key; } action = $key.attr('data-action'); if (timer - (last.eventTime || 0) < o.preventDoubleEventTime) {